Cant fault anything to be honest, gemmed/enchanted/reforged correctly. Only thing I will say is missing manafeed and specced into doom and gloom instead, manafeed is great for longer fights especially now as moving into heroic raids, less life tapping, less pressure on healers and more uptime because of less life tapping is according to theorycraft a DPS gain.

This will mean 3 destruction locks, which will probably mean one of us really should go Demo as we will recruit you instead of an ele shammy for the 10% sp buff.
